Eglinton Crosstown West Extension (ECWE) Project
The multicultural Greater Toronto Area’s transit system is undergoing significant expansion. One of the key projects currently in progress is the Eglinton Crosstown West Extension (ECWE), a new rapid transit line designed to enhance connectivity along a major east-west corridor in Toronto.
Project Benefits
- Improves transit access to the west end of Toronto and into Mississauga, Canada’s sixth-largest city.
- Enhances quality of life for daily commuters traveling between these two cities along Lake Ontario.
- Supports regional economic growth and reduces traffic congestion.
